Transaction 77aebf2360cb9101772aadfc67f4a3992bedc8f20345ab682815d69006e70511

block
9c8eb26a61a6e964764d09c8126091df2e5042e0249fd47df2dcc4e8a9b69cc8

1 Input

3 Outputs